What is a global block?

Global blocks. For other recent discussion and questions, see the Global locks talk page. Global blocks are technical actions performed to prevent an IP address or range of IP addresses from editing all Wikimedia wikis, for a fixed period of time or indefinitely. What is the difference between global blocking and IP blocking?

Global blocks disable account creation from the blocked IP by default, and can also prevent editing while logged in to an account. Global blocks cannot be applied directly to accounts. For the analogous action with accounts, see global locks . IP blocking is the only form of global blocking that is technically possible.

How does the globalblocking extension work?

The GlobalBlocking extension can block an IP address or range (maximum of /16 in IPv4, maximum of /19 in IPv6) from editing all Wikimedia projects except Meta, and is only available to Stewards or selected WMF staff in special groups like WMF Support and Safety. These are logged in the Global block log .

What is global lock function in C++?

GlobalLock function. Locks a global memory object and returns a pointer to the first byte of the object’s memory block. Note The global functions have greater overhead and provide fewer features than other memory management functions. New applications should use the heap functions unless documentation states that a global function should be used.
